Lawn Drainage in Birmingham, AL
Lawn drainage services focus on improving the way water moves across a property to prevent pooling, erosion, and water damage. These services typically involve installing drainage systems such as French drains, channel drains, or grading adjustments to direct excess water away from foundations, walkways, and landscaped areas. Property owners often seek drainage solutions when experiencing persistent soggy spots, flooding after heavy rains, or water runoff that threatens the stability of lawns and gardens. Understanding the specific drainage issues and the layout of the property helps determine the most effective approach to manage water flow and protect the landscape.
Before requesting lawn drainage services, property owners should consider the extent of water problems, the areas most affected, and any existing drainage features. It’s helpful to evaluate the slope of the yard, the location of gutters and downspouts, and the overall landscape design. Clarifying goals, such as preventing basement flooding or maintaining a healthy lawn, can guide the selection of appropriate drainage methods. Proper assessment ensures the installation or improvement of drainage systems that effectively manage water while complementing the property's overall landscape.

Common Lawn Drainage Jobs
French Drain Installation - directs excess water away from the foundation to prevent pooling and flooding.
Surface Drainage Solutions - improves yard runoff to reduce erosion and soggy areas.
Drainage System Repair - addresses clogs, leaks, or damage in existing drainage infrastructure.
Grading and Sloping - adjusts yard contours to promote proper water flow away from the home.
Catch Basin and Channel Drains - captures surface water to prevent basement flooding and landscape damage.
Drainage System Maintenance - ensures existing drainage components function effectively over time.
